What is the sum of a 52-term arithmetic sequence where the first term is 6 and the last term is 363?

Respuesta :

MissPhiladelphia
MissPhiladelphia MissPhiladelphia
  • 18-04-2017

The sum of the arithmetic sequence where the first term is 6 and the last term is 363 is 9594. 

Sum of an arithmetic sequence: Sn=n2(a1+an), where a1 is the first term and an is the last term.
